Princeton University features an indoor climbing facility known as the Princeton University Indoor Climbing Wall, located within the Dillon Gymnasium. The climbing wall primarily offers top-rope climbing and bouldering options, making it accessible to climbers of all abilities. The facility is known for regularly updated route settings, providing a variety of challenges for users. It emphasizes a supportive community environment and offers various programs to encourage both student and public engagement.
This climbing wall serves as a valuable resource for fostering climbing skills and promoting fitness among Princeton students as well as the surrounding community.
